Driving Assistance Package
%
The availability of some functions or sub-func-
tions of the Driving Assistance Package is
equipment- or country-specific. The range of
functions in your Driving Assistance Package
may differ from the functions listed here.
The functions Active Distance Assist
DISTRONIC, Active Blind Spot Assist, Active
Brake Assist, Active Lane Keeping Assist and
Active Emergency Stop Assist are also availa-
ble without the Driving Assistance Package,
albeit with restricted functionality.

Function of ABS
The Anti-lock Brake System (ABS) regulates the
brake pressure in critical driving situations:
page 220)
During braking, for instance, at maximum full-
R
stop braking or if there is insufficient tire trac-
tion, the wheels are prevented from locking.
Vehicle steerability while braking is ensured.
R
If ABS intervenes when braking, you will feel a
pulsing in the brake pedal. The pulsating brake
pedal can be an indication of hazardous road con-
ditions and can serve as a reminder to take extra
care while driving.
System limits
ABS is active from speeds of approx. 3 mph
R
(5 km/h).
